    Lisa Blackpink Biography

    Lisa, whose real name is Pranpriya Manobal, is a Thai singer, rapper, and dancer best known as a member of the globally renowned K-pop group, Blackpink. Born on March 27, 1997, in Bangkok, Thailand, Lisa has captivated audiences worldwide with her unique talents and charismatic personality.

    Before joining Blackpink, Lisa trained for five years at YG Entertainment, where she honed her skills in singing, rapping, and dancing. Her dedication and hard work paid off when she officially debuted with the group in 2016. Since then, Lisa has become one of the most recognizable faces in the music industry, earning millions of fans across the globe.

    What is Deepfake?

    Definition and Origins

    Deepfake refers to the use of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ning algorithms to create realistic but fake audio, video, or images. The term "deepfake" is a combination of "deep learning" and "fake," reflecting the technology's reliance on advanced AI techniques. Deepfakes first gained attention in 2017 when they were used to create convincing but false videos of celebrities.

    How Deepfakes Work

    The process of creating a deepfake involves training neural networks on large datasets of images or videos. These networks learn to replicate the appearance and behavior of individuals, allowing creators to manipulate digital content with unprecedented accuracy. While initially used for entertainment purposes, deepfakes have since evolved into a powerful tool with both positive and negative applications.

    The Technology Behind Deepfakes

    The technology behind Lisa Blackpink deepfake involves sophisticated AI algorithms and machine learning models. Generative Adversarial Networks (GANs) are commonly used to create deepfakes, as they excel at generating realistic but fake content. GANs consist of two neural networks: a generator that creates fake content and a discriminator that evaluates its authenticity.

    Advancements in AI technology have made deepfake creation more accessible than ever before. While this democratization of technology offers exciting possibilities, it also increases the potential for misuse and abuse.
